Developer and publisher Luxorix Games has released its new tactical roguelike on PC today. Called Deadlock Station, it’s a roguelike where the actual fight is almost like a puzzle you’re solving before anything starts.
In Deadlock Station, you pick three characters and send them into an autobattle adventure against alien enemies. The characters move and act on their own, and you just influence the fight indirectly through positioning, abilities, equipment, and battlefield mechanics.
You can build spike walls, create defensive positions, make choke points, lure enemies into traps, push them onto hazards or land mines, and even use enemies themselves to help set up a better situation.
The gameplay most resembles Dungeon of the Endless, with some tower-defense elements that aren’t that similar, though. There are 10 distinct characters, and experimenting with different squad compositions and ability combinations is a big part of making each run feel different.
Deadlock Station also has some tech involved, including Energy Shields and Time Weapons. You need them as you’ll run into deadly Ravagers, outsmart Renegades, and deal with other dangerous alien threats across different environments and objectives.
The base-building and progression happen outside the battles, too. And there’s a lot of meta-progression here. Every successful run and Station upgrade expands your options, letting you unlock new quests, weapons, gear, and abilities.
You can also unlock new characters and factions, develop your base, strengthen your squad, and keep building out different combinations of abilities, equipment, and tactics. Meanwhile, as you explore unknown territories, you’ll uncover the truth behind the Event and work out what happened to humanity.
